Re: T31 bash plate
The insulation is there on the plastic nissan bash plate to prevent it being damaged by heat of the exhaust pipes and to reduce rattle. It has nothing to do with sound insulation I believe.
The metal bash plate has two soft pads (the red circles) that stop the bash plate from vibrating.
